New Green Beauty Brand Alert! Check Out Saje Wellness

July 3rd, 2018 by Karen 14 Comments

saje wellness store
The Saje Wellness store, The Village at Corte Madera shopping center about 10 minutes north of San Francisco

Have you heard of Saje Wellness? They’re kindasorta like the Canadian Aveda, and all of their products, which are cruelty-free, are made using plant-based essential oil blends, with lots of products for your body and your home.

I walked into their new store in Corte Madera the other day and was like, WHOA! — what’s happening over there by that plant wall?

saje wellness corte madera store
Inside the store

These geometric gems are scent diffusers. You fill ’em with water, add a few drops of essential oil to evoke the mood you want to set (calming, energizing, etc.), and the fragrant mist fills your space.

The store manager (hi, Alexis!) said that the brand started when one of the founders got into a car accident and wanted to find a natural way to manage his pain. The first product they launched (also their bestselling item) is a stress relief essential oil blend called Peppermint Halo Cooling and Soothing Blend for the Head.

saje wellness peppermint halo
Peppermint Halo: their #1 bestselling product
saje wellness oil blends offer
There’s currently a sale!

When Alexis put a little on the back of my neck and my shoulders, the first thing I noticed was the fresh minty scent. It was definitely there but wasn’t overwhelming (I didn’t feel like I was drowning in a sea of mint!). Within a minute, I felt a gentle tingle on my skin, and my neck and shoulders slowly relaxing.

Ah…

I usually hold most of my tension up there, but my trapezoids, shoulders and neck stayed tingly and loose-y-goose-y for 45 minutes. *trying to figure out a way to wrap my entire body in the stuff all day long, haha!*

A travel-sized 0.34-oz. bottle of Peppermint Halo $26.95.

The store also carries many other natural products made from their family of essential oils, like bath soaps, household cleaning supplies, body lotions and baby products.
